• ベストアンサー

JavaScript で動的に <SELECT>の<OPTION>を追加したい

HTML の <FORM> の <SELECT> <OPTION VALUE="11">AAA</OPTION> の<OPTION >を JavaScript で設定しようと考えています。 方法ご存知の方いらっしゃいましたら、御教授願います。 また、JavaScript のメソッド/プロパティが網羅的に記述されている Web Page 等ありましたら、ぜひURLを教えてください。 よろしくお願い致します。

質問者が選んだベストアンサー

  • ベストアンサー
  • a-kuma
  • ベストアンサー率50% (1122/2211)
回答No.1

> の<OPTION >を JavaScript で設定しようと考えています。 例えば、こんな感じでやります。 <form name="F"> <select name="S"> </select> </form> <!-- ★★★★★★ ここから --> <script type="text/JavaScript"> S = document.X.S; if (S.options.length < 1) { S.options[0] = new Option("ラベル1", "値1"); S.options[1] = new Option("ラベル2", "値2"); S.options[2] = new Option("ラベル3", "値3"); history.go(0); } </script> "ラベルn" が属性 label に対応し、"値n" が属性 value に対応します。 > また、JavaScript のメソッド/プロパティが網羅的に記述されている Web Page 等ありましたら、ぜひURLを教えてください。 私は、本家のページ(→参考URL)を良く見ます。

参考URL:
http://developer.netscape.com/docs/manuals/communicator/jsref/index.htm
sho_ta
質問者

お礼

大変助かりました。 またよろしくお願いします。

関連するQ&A